Abstract

In Poland Jerzy Szymik is a precursor of a scientific research on literature analysed from a theological perspective and treated as a locus theologicus. Literature and books are topics explored extremely often in the works of Jerzy Szymik, both in his essays, religious articles and poetry. The purpose of this paper is to present the most vital aspects of the topics. Presence of the art of reading as well as joy of reading as a poetic  theme seems to be of a particular interest.
